Top Affordable Journalism Colleges in Maryland for 2022
Rank |
College |
Fees/Cost |
Type of Institute |
Degrees & Awards |
Address |
1 | Harford Community College | $7,359 | 2-year, Public | Less than one year certificate|One but less than two years certificate|Associate’s degree | 401 Thomas Run Rd, Bel Air, Maryland 21015-1698 |
2 | Bowie State University | $14,321 | 4-year, Public | Bachelor’s degree|Postbaccalaureate certificate|Master’s degree|Post-master’s certificate|Doctor’s degree – research/scholarship | 14000 Jericho Park Rd, Bowie, Maryland 20715-9465 |
3 | Morgan State University | $15,998 | 4-year, Public | Bachelor’s degree|Postbaccalaureate certificate|Master’s degree|Doctor’s degree – research/scholarship | 1700 East Cold Spring Lane, Baltimore, Maryland 21251-0001 |
4 | University of Maryland-College Park | $17,723 | 4-year, Public | Two but less than 4 years certificate|Bachelor’s degree|Postbaccalaureate certificate|Master’s degree|Post-master’s certificate|Doctor’s degree – research/scholarship|Doctor’s degree – professional practice | College Park, Maryland 20742 |
5 | Washington Adventist University | $18,754 | 4-year, Private not-for-profit | One but less than two years certificate|Associate’s degree|Two but less than 4 years certificate|Bachelor’s degree|Master’s degree | 7600 Flower Ave, Takoma Park, Maryland 20912 |

Admission requirements and tests
These are some of the popular admission requirements –
- Secondary School GPA
- Secondary School Rank
- Secondary School Record
- Completion of college-preparatory Program
- Recommendations
- Admission Tests (SAT/ACT)
- TOEFL
Depending upon the college, the above requirements may be labeled as – required, recommended or considered but not required.
